About The Role

The Quality Engineering Team (QET) serves as a center of excellence promoting a shift-left approach and standardized process, tools, and frameworks to enhance the overall quality of core applications & services across multiple Arctic Wolf Network Cyber Security SaaS product offerings (Managed Risk, Managed Detection & Response, Incident Response, and Managed Awareness). We partner closely with R&D leadership across each product line and act as a center of expertise, best practice, and continuous improvement developing joint quality.

We are looking for a passionate Principal SDET Quality Engineer to help architect and build scalable test automation frameworks & strategies that will be leveraged across multiple product areas. This principal engineer role will champion innovation through test automation and best practice to improve quality, efficiency, and reliability. The ideal candidate has developed strategic visions, automation roadmaps, and built multiple stable, scalable, and reliable automation frameworks that have been running successfully and provided extensive quality benefits.

Responsibilities:

  • Evangelize strategic quality initiatives & automation strategies with key stakeholders and R&D leadership.

  • Lead targeted quality projects & collaborate with product teams to ensure successful implementation.

  • Lead the evaluation and selection of new automation tools, test tools, or test frameworks that will be leveraged to improve product quality and reduce test automation gaps.

  • Collaborate directly with QE/automation engineers to drive complex E2E automation solutions and influence decisions and outcomes across all teams.

  • Represent QET at engineering roundtables, joint R&D planning sessions, brown bags, etc. to align engineering & quality practices across R&D technical leadership.

  • Directly consult with a product team as required to assist with designing & building an optimal test automation solution in that area.

  • Coach and mentor QE or automaton engineers and provide input to leadership on development needs or growth opportunities for team members.

  • Stay updated on the latest testing methodologies, tools, and industry best practices to continuously improve quality process at Arctic Wolf.

Required Skills and Experience:

An ideal candidate for this role should meet these minimum requirements:

  • MS/BS in Computer Science, Engineering, or related discipline

  • 10+ years relevant experience in roles spanning quality engineering, test automation, infrastructure automation, and/or software development in test (SDET)

  • 5+ years in hands-on leadership roles designing and implementing quality & automation strategies across product lines.

  • Strong domain understanding of QA methodologies & can apply those methodologies in test plan/test strategy development.

  • Experience leading QA activities in a fast-paced Agile development team, with hands-on experiences in analyzing requirements, converting requirements into meaningful test scenarios, and implementing effective test cases and harnesses accordingly.

  • Proficient in multiple common test automation frameworks and/or tooling (Pytest, Robot, Cucumber, xUnit, NUnit, Jasime, Ginkgo, Testify, TestNG, Selenium, Cypress, etc.)

  • Proficient in one or more high-level programming languages (Java, GoLang, C#, Python, etc.)

  • Experience in AWS, Docker, Kubernetes, Terraform, Helm, Harness, Nomad, or Consul is plus.

Interview Process:

Initial Candidate Pre-Screening: A recruiter will contact you to briefly discuss your work history and provide an overview of Arctic Wolf.

Engineering Screening Interview(s): An R&D executive and/or manager will connect to provide more detail context on the organization, team, role, and position. You will share your project and qualifications as it relates to the role you are applying for.

Engineering Technical Interview(s): One or more interviews will be scheduled with potential team members or key stakeholders this position would interface with. Be prepared to collaborate on a technical topics and problems. Also talk more about past projects and your career goals.

Final Engineering Interview: Will be scheduled as required with an R&D executive or manager. Objective is to discuss any final details on the position & opportunity, team & project context, and ensure a final fit with the organization.
